L. , Cheung Carol Yim-lui TITLE=Repeatability and Reproducibility of Retinal Neuronal and Axonal Measures on Spectral-Domain Optical Coherence Tomography in Patients with Cognitive Impairment JOURNAL=Frontiers in Neurology VOLUME=Volume 8 - 2017 YEAR=2017 URL=https://www.frontiersin.org/journals/neurology/articles/10.3389/fneur.2017.00359 DOI=10.3389/fneur.2017.00359 ISSN=1664-2295 ABSTRACT=(Keywords: Retina, Reproducibility, Repeatability, Mild Cognitive Impairment, Dementia, Optical Coherence Tomography) Background: With increasing interest in determining if measurement of retinal neuronal structure with spectral-domain optical coherence tomography (SD-OCT) is useful in accessing neurodegenerative process in cognitive decline and development of dementia, it is important to evaluate whether the SD-OCT measurements are repeatable and reproducible in patients with Alzheimer’s disease (AD) or mild cognitive impairment (MCI). Methods: This is a retrospective cohort study. Patients with AD or MCI with no change in global clinical dementia rating (CDR) score at 1-year follow-up were eligible to be included. (GC-IPL) Macular ganglion-cell inner plexiform layer (GC-IPL) and peripapillary retinal nerve fiver layer (RNFL) thicknesses were measured with a SD-OCT (Cirrus HD-OCT, Carl Zeiss Meditec, Dublin, CA) at baseline, 6-month and 1-year follow-up visits. At baseline, SD-OCT scans were repeated to access intra-visit repeatability of the SD-OCT measurement. SD-OCT measurement over three visits were used to access inter-visit reproducibility. We calculated intra-class coefficients (ICC) and coefficients of variation (CoV). Results: We included 32 patients with stable AD and 29 patients with stable MCI in the final analysis. For GC-IPL measures, the average intra-visit ICC was 0.969 (range: 0.948-0.985) and CoV was 1.81% (range: 1.14-2.40%); while the average inter-visit ICC was 0.968 (range: 0.941-0.985) and CoV was 1.91% (range: 1.24-2.32%). The average ICC and CoV of intra-visit RNFL measured was 0.965 (range: 0.937-0.986) and 2.32% (range: 1.34-2.90%). The average ICC and CoV of inter-visit RNFL measures was 0.927 (range: 0.845-0.961) and 3.83% (range: 2.71-5.25%). Conclusions: Both GC-IPL and RNFL thickness measurements had good intra-visit repeatability and inter-visit reproducibility over 1 year in elderly patients with stable AD and MCI, suggesting that SD-OCT is a reliable tool to assess neurodegenerative process over time.
